No vehicle shall be parked on any unpaved area on a Lot, nor on any <br /> street or road right-of-way adjacent to the Lot or to any other part vf the Property. <br /> 2.6 Comman Areas. The Common Areas shall be owned and maintained at all times <br /> by the Association. The Private Road Outlots shall be used solely for pedestrian and vehicular <br /> ingress and egress as provided in Section 2.8 below. Outlot C shall be used by the Owners for <br /> recrearional purposes, subject to such rules as the Assoeiation shall establish from time to time. <br /> Outlot H shall be used as a tree preservation and buffer $rea. <br /> 2.7 Tree Preservation and Tree Plantin�. Each Owner of a Lot ather than the Big <br /> Woods Lots shall replace each Signific�t Tree removed from such Owner's Lot with two (2) <br /> Replacement Trees to replace the Significant Tree so removed.
